soc: samsung: asv: Print error code when adding an OPP fails 49/200149/3
authorSylwester Nawrocki <s.nawrocki@samsung.com>
Wed, 30 Jan 2019 17:17:23 +0000 (18:17 +0100)
committerSylwester Nawrocki <s.nawrocki@samsung.com>
Wed, 27 Mar 2019 11:18:53 +0000 (12:18 +0100)
Log error code from devm_pm_opp_add() to make any errors easier
to debug.

Change-Id: If418320565f1efc14d16242d8b166bea07353c54
Signed-off-by: Sylwester Nawrocki <s.nawrocki@samsung.com>
drivers/soc/samsung/exynos-asv.c

index 611c374..71fa32f 100644 (file)
@@ -78,8 +78,8 @@ int exynos_asv_update_cpu_opp(struct device *cpu)
 
                err = dev_pm_opp_add(cpu, opp_freq, new_voltage);
                if (err < 0)
-                       pr_err("%s: Failed to add OPP %u Hz/%u uV for cpu%d\n",
-                              __func__, opp_freq, new_voltage, cpu->id);
+                       pr_err("%s: Failed to add OPP %u Hz/%u uV for cpu%d (%d)\n",
+                              __func__, opp_freq, new_voltage, cpu->id, err);
        }
 
        return 0;